Door Stopper Installation in Kansas City, KS
Door stopper installation services help homeowners secure doors in an open or closed position, preventing unwanted movement and providing added safety and convenience. This service covers a variety of projects, including installing door stoppers on interior and exterior doors, adjusting existing stops for better functionality, and selecting the right type of stopper for different door materials and usage needs. Property owners often want to understand the different styles available-such as wall-mounted, floor-mounted, or hinge-mounted options-and how each can suit their specific doors and spaces.
Before requesting door stopper installation, property owners typically consider factors like the door’s material, frequency of use, and the desired level of protection against door swings or impacts. It’s also helpful to understand the placement options to avoid interference with door hardware or furniture. Proper installation ensures that the stopper functions effectively, reducing the risk of damage to walls, furniture, or the door itself, and enhancing overall safety within the home.

Door Stopper Installation Questions
What is the purpose of a door stopper? A door stopper prevents doors from swinging too far and causing damage to walls or furniture.
What types of door stoppers are available? Common options include wedge-shaped, wall-mounted, and hinge-mounted stoppers designed for different door types.
Where should a door stopper be installed? They are typically placed at the base of the door or on the wall behind the door to stop it from opening too far.
Can door stoppers be installed on any door? Most doors can accommodate a door stopper, but the best type depends on door material and usage.
